    Ludwig Gustav Adolf von ESTORFF, GdI (* 25. Dezember 1859 in Hannover; ? 5. Oktober 1943 in Uelzen)

    - Lt.-Pat. 15.04.1878 (1. Th?ringischen Infanterie-Regiment Nr. 31)

    - ???

    - 18.07.1894: Hauptmann in Swakopmund (Deutsch-S?dwestafrika)

    - 1904: Mayor (F?hrer from the Westabteilung (Herero-war)) ???

    - 1907 to 1911: commander Schutztruppe in Deutsch-S?dwestafrika

    - ???

    - 01.10.12-01.09.14: commander 68. Intanterie-Brigade

    - 15.05.15-30.08.16: commander 103. Intanterie-Division

    - 20.09.16-16.03.18: commander 42. Intanterie-Division

    - 16.03.18-17.12.18: commander Generalkommando 60

    - 17.12.18-20.01.19: commander 8. Armee

    Pour le M?rite 06.09.1917.

    Jens,

    A bit more information on his career:

    Ludwig von Estorff (1859-1943)

    01.10.19-08.04.20 mit d. F?hr. d. Reichswehr Gruppen Kdo 3 beauftr., zugl. mit d. F?hr. d. Wehrkreis Kdo I beauftr.

    25.02.19-01.10.19 mit d. F?hr. d. I. AK beauftr.

    05.02.19-25.02.19 Gouv. v. K?nigsberg

    20.01.19-05.02.19 Offizier v.d. Armee

    17.12.18-20.01.19 stellv. Oberbefehlshaber d. 8. Armee

    16.03.18-17.12.18 F?hr. d. Gen. Kdo z.b.V. 60

    07.11.16-16.03.18 Kom. d. 42. Div.

    11.09.16-07.11.16 Offizier v.d. Armee

    11.05.15-11.09.16 Kom. d. 103. Inf. Div.

    11.09.14-11.05.15 Offizier v.d. Armee

    01.09.14 schwer verwundet- Lazarett

    01.10.12-01.09.14 Kom. d. 68. Inf. Brig. (Metz)

    20.03.11-01.10.12 Kom. d. Inf. R. 92 (Braunschweig)

    22.03.07-20.03.11 Kom. d. Schutztr. f. SWA (Windhut)

    04.01.06-22.03.07 Kom. d. 2. Feldregt. d. Schutztr. f. SWA

    25.06.04-04.01.06 Batl. Kom. i. 1. Feldregt. d. Schutztr. f. SWA (z. Verf?g. d. Kom. d. Schutztr.)

    19.02.04-25.06.04 i. Schutztr. f. SWA

    18.07.03-19.02.04 I./F?s. R. 35

    06.02.02-18.07.03 b.m.d. Stellvert. d. Kom. d. Schutztr. f. SWA

    12.03.01-06.02.02 Major i. Schutztr. f. SWA

    09.06.00-12.03.01 Major i. Schutztr. f. DOA

    18.04.00-09.06.00 k.z. Oberkomdo d. Schutztr., ? l.s. Gen. St.

    13.09.99-18.04.00 i. gr. Gen. St.

    04.06.94-09.07.99 Komp. Chef i. Schutztr. f. SWA

    11.06.94-04.06.94 i. Schutztr. f. SWA

    14.09.93-11.06.94 Chef 9./Inf. R. 31 (Altona)

    29.03.92-14.09.93 k.z. Gen. St. v. Inf. R. 31

    01.10.88-20.07.91 k.z. Kr. Akad. v. Inf. R. 31

    1888-01.10.88 in 9./Inf. R. 31 (Altona)

    1887 in 7./Inf. R. 31 (Altona)

    01.10.83-30.09.86 in 2./Unteroff. Sch. i. Marienwerder v. Inf. R. 31

    1879-1882 in 8./Inf. R. 31 (Altona)

    15.04.78 Sek.Lt. i. Inf. R. 31 (Altona)

    Gen.Maj. 01-10-12 U

    Oberst 20-04-09 V

    Oberstlt. 10-04-06 F3f

    Major 27-01-00 L2l

    Hptm. 14-09-93

    Oblt. 13-12-87

    Leutn. 15-04-78
